Chesterton: early deeds

Description

Grant by Richard Sowe to his son Richard, and Joan his wife, formerly daughter of John Blount of 'Simtenfeld', of his messuage, lands and tenements in Chesterton which he had by gift and feoffment of Hugh Loges his father. To hold the same to the said Richard, Joan and the heirs of their bodies, form the chief lord of the fee for services due and accustomed. For default of issue, remainder to the next heir of grantor. Warranty clause Witnesses: Nicholas Balance of Ashorne; Thomas Wan/udak; Robert Warde of Pillerton; Henry Tanney; William Farmesham of Chesterton; John Caldecote of the same; Thomas Henrith of the same Dated at Chesterton, Thursday the vigil of St Laurence the martyr, 18 Edward II
